Meeting Point and Pickup

The tour meeting point is located near the second-floor exit of the Colosseum metro station, providing a convenient starting point for guests. Participants are advised to arrive 20 minutes prior to the scheduled tour start time and to bring a valid ID for verification purposes.

The tour concludes at the Roman Forum, allowing visitors to seamlessly continue their exploration of ancient Rome’s iconic landmarks.
